What is Chiropractic Care?

Chiropractic care is a hands-on, non-invasive, and drug-free practice that effectively helps relive pain and improve the body’s overall function.

It uses various treatments depending on an individual’s needs, from manual hands-on adjustment techniques to soft tissue therapy.

Chiropractic care is provided by a Licensed Chiropractor to help treat the muscles, joints and nerves in your body.

The goal of chiropractic treatment at our clinic is to improve your body’s alignment, increase spinal mobility, and improve overall physical functioning.
